1) Google search

One of the easiest ways to find out more about somebody is to do a simple Google search. This will pull up any information about the individual that is available online. 

When searching, use quotes around their name to ensure that the results are specific to that individual. You can also add keywords, such as their city or occupation, to narrow down the results. 

2) Social media search

Most people have at least one social media account: Facebook, Twitter, Instagram, or LinkedIn. These platforms allow you to see what someone is interested in, who their friends are, where they’ve been, and much more.

To start your social media search, simply type the person’s name into the search bar of each platform and see what comes up. On Facebook, you can narrow down your search by location or workplace. On LinkedIn, you can see their job history and education.

You can also check out their public posts and any groups or pages they follow. These can give you valuable insights into their personality, beliefs, and interests.

One word of caution: be careful not to come across as a stalker or invade someone’s privacy. Don’t send friend requests or message them unless you have a valid reason.

Also, keep in mind that not everything you see on social media is accurate or up-to-date. Take everything with a grain of salt, and don’t make assumptions based on limited data.

3) Public records search

A public records search can provide details on someone’s criminal history, marriage and divorce records, bankruptcies, and more. Many government websites offer access to public records for free, while others may charge a fee. 

It’s important to note that not all public records may be available online, and some may require a visit to a local courthouse or government office. 

4) Property records search

Conducting a property records search can help you unveil where someone lives, how much their home is worth, and other property-related details. 

Many counties and cities have websites that allow you to search property records by address or name. Alternatively, you can use websites like Zillow or Redfin to search for property details. Note that not all property records may be available online, and there may be fees associated with accessing certain records.

5) Education history search

Another useful way to gather facts about someone online is by conducting an educational history search. It can be done through various websites, including LinkedIn and university directories. 

Doing so lets you learn where someone attended school, what they studied, and their academic achievements. This can provide insight into their interests, skills, and qualifications. However, not all educational history info may be publicly available, especially if someone has chosen to keep it private.

6) News article search

Conducting a news article search involves searching for any news articles that mention the person by name or any relevant facts about them. This can help you determine if they have been involved in notable events, controversies, or achievements. 

You can use Google News or Bing News to search for news articles related to them. Additionally, you can search for local news sources in the area where the person lives or works. Remember that not all news articles may be accurate or up-to-date, so it’s important to fact-check and verify any information you find.

7) Online discussion forums

Another way to learn more about somebody is to search for them on online discussion forums. If the person has been actively engaged in forums related to their interests or hobbies, you can get a better sense of their personality, beliefs, and viewpoints. 

Try searching for the individual’s name or username on forums related to their profession, interests, or even on Reddit. Keep in mind that not all forums allow personal data to be shared, so respect others’ privacy.

8) Job search websites

Websites like Indeed or Monster can provide a wealth of information about someone’s career path, skills, and employment history. By searching for their name on these platforms, you can gain insights into the types of jobs they’ve held, the companies they’ve worked for, and their professional network. You may even discover they have skills or experience you didn’t know about before.

10) Reverse image search

Reverse image search involves using a search engine such as Google or TinEye to search for any instances of an image the person has shared online. This can reveal additional social media profiles, blog posts, or news articles featuring the individual. 

To conduct a reverse image search, simply upload the photo to the search engine’s image search function or enter the image’s URL. It’s a quick and easy way to uncover more details about someone.
